What's the Story

"Coraline" by Neil Gaiman follows the adventures of Coraline Jones, a curious and courageous young girl who discovers a mysterious door in her new home. Beyond the door lies an alternate world that mirrors her own but with unsettling differences, including an Other Mother who seeks to keep Coraline there forever. As Coraline explores this eerie parallel reality, she encounters strange beings and uncovers dark secrets. With the help of a talking cat and her wits, Coraline must confront the Other Mother to save herself and her family from a sinister fate. Gaiman's captivating storytelling and eerie atmosphere make "Coraline" a modern classic that enthralls readers of all ages.

Key Points from the Book

01.

The Mysterious Door: Coraline discovers a hidden door in her new home that leads to an alternate world. This door becomes the gateway to a fantastical and eerie adventure.

02.

The Other World: Beyond the door, Coraline finds an alternate version of her life where everything seems better at first glance. However, things quickly take a sinister turn as she realizes the true nature of this other world.

03.

The Other Mother: Coraline encounters the Other Mother, a manipulative and sinister entity who initially appears caring and kind. However, she has a dark agenda and wants to keep Coraline trapped in her world forever.

04.

Courage and Bravery: Coraline must summon courage and bravery to confront the challenges and dangers presented by the Other Mother. Her determination to save herself and her real parents drives her actions throughout the story.
